Output ffdb91db140eefcfbefec6a3c1d2d70fac83ce81bee8e7dc3ffe7f747f08c436:0

value
10094
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fa9fb65e261ee7c7af253c608a217dda02b13aea OP_EQUAL
address
3QYCBWdTdoKFAzSmbC572rPUo1ksvJHtZJ
transaction
ffdb91db140eefcfbefec6a3c1d2d70fac83ce81bee8e7dc3ffe7f747f08c436
confirmations
241772
spent
true